=={{header|Wren}}== |
|||
This is loosely based on the Kotlin entry. |
|||
However, Wren uses co-operatively scheduled fibers rather than threads for concurrency and, as long as a philosoper waits until he can pick up both forks to eat, deadlock is impossible because only one fiber can run at a time. |
